Mortgage - Stuck just below 700... NEED a 700

Hello all!

 

Long story short: I need to relocate 60 miles to take care of an elderly relative.  My current home has FHA mortgage (refinanced last year after a divorce).  COVID-19 has roiled the mortgage markets, and I don't have a full 20% to put down.  A local credit union is working with me for a 10% down mortgage, but two of my three bureau scores must be 700 or above.

 

Last month my scores were 696 (Equifax - FICO 5), 703 (TU - FICO 4) and 698 (Experian - FICO 2).  These are the FICO versions the credit union uses.  But at the same time, I had $3000 on a "0%/36 month" credit account.  So I thought I'd be smart and pay it off.  I did, and the only change was that my Experian FICO score dropped to 690.

 

Other details: divorce shoved me into a Chapter 7 bankruptcy, which was discharged in August 2017.  All secured loans at the time were reaffirmed and paid off.  Since then:

  • Four credit cards (two VISA, two Sweetwater consumer).  Total credit line is $16,500.  $0 balance on all of them.
  • Mortgage, paid 100% on time.
  • Auto loan, paid 100% on time.
  • Student loans (thanks to the ex-wife), being paid but the government is reporting them in deferment due to COVID-19.

I really can't think of anything else to do.  I've heard a rumor that having $0 balance on a credit card will actually lower a score, but then again, having over 10% will too.

 

Any ideas?  Thank you all!

Re: Mortgage - Stuck just below 700... NEED a 700

It appears you're close enough that having 1 revolving credit card (not a charge card, etc.) reporting a balance of 1% but not more than 8.9% of its respective credit line should hopefully get you the points you need. You're very close, so I'd also recommend not having any new inquiries, etc or other changes on your credit report before your lender pulls credit again.

Re: Mortgage - Stuck just below 700... NEED a 700

@Vandervecken  Great advise from above. Reporting all zero utilization on revolving accounts will gain you penalty points.

 

Look into AZEO Technique. All Zero Except One card reporting a small balance e.g. $5-$10.

Re: Mortgage - Stuck just below 700... NEED a 700

I just wish TU would hurry up and process.  Capital One updates all three bureaus on the day after the statement is generated.

 

As far as the student loans, mine are owned by the government.  From what the servicer told me, unless the borrower has requested otherwise, ALL federally-owned student loans are automatically reporting as "deferred" due to COVID-19 instructions from the Department of Education.  When I mentioned this to the loan officer, she said "we'll just use 1% of the balance as your payment for calculating your DTI."
